AWStats

Fiche logiciel validé
  • Création ou MAJ importante : 23/12/09
  • Correction mineure : 22/02/13
Mots-clés
Pour aller plus loin

AWStats : statistiques utilisation serveurs web, mail...

Description
Fonctionnalités générales
  • production de statistiques graphiques d'utilisation à partir de l'analyse des log de serveurs web, mail, ftp, proxy ou de streaming.
  • fonctionne sous forme de CGI ou de ligne de commande.
  • production des pages de comptes-rendus dynamiques ou statiques avec des informations détaillées sur le client et l'utilisation du site Web (durée de navigation, taille 'downloadée' pour les visites).
  • possibilité d'application de filtres d'inclusion ou d'exclusion sur la liste complète des URL consultées.
Autres fonctionnalités
  • paramétrage par fichier de configuration.
  • interface de paramétrage intégré avec WEBMIN (interface web d'administration de systèmes Unix).
  • reverse DNS avant ou pendant l'analyse.
  • plusieurs formats pour les fichiers de calculs (texte, XML).
  • analyse de la présence de nombreux plug-in.
Interopérabilité
  • capable de lire de nombreux types de fichiers de log.
  • les résultats des calculs de consultation sont stockés dans des fichiers textes, avec possibilité d'exporter en XML pour une ré-exploitation dans un autre logiciel.
Contexte d'utilisation dans mon laboratoire/service

Utilisé pour l'analyse de fréquentation des sites Web de l'INIST (une cinquantaine de serveurs), en parallèle avec PhpMyVisites (plutôt orienté utilisateur final) et Google analytics (pour les sites à grosse fréquentation). Permet de travailler sur une rétrospective à partir de fichiers de log archivés et sur les sites pour lesquels on ne peut pas modifier les pages (insertion du code javascript nécessaire aux comptages de PhpMyVisit ou GoogleAnalytics).
Aussi utilisé pour les certaines statistiques du serveur PLUME : http://www.projet-plume.org/le-projet-tableau-de-bord

Environnement du logiciel
Distributions dans lesquelles ce logiciel est intégré

Fait partie des packages Linux debian standard avec quelques versions de retard (validation nécessaire)

Plates-formes

Toutes, mais a besoin de Perl.

Logiciels connexes
Autres logiciels aux fonctionnalités équivalentes
Environnement de développement
Type de structure associée au développement

Libre, auteur : Laurent Destailleur (Eldy)

Eléments de pérennité

Largement adopté par la communauté du libre, présent comme analyseur de statistiques de consultation de nombreux fournisseurs d'accès (free, ouvaton...).
Traduit en 41 langues.
Régulièrement mis à jour

Références d'utilisateurs institutionnels

Plus de 37000 téléchargements de la version Windows 6.6 (équivalent sur les autres plateformes) sur le site de sourceforge au 2/05/2007

Environnement utilisateur
Liste de diffusion ou de discussion, support et forums
Documentation utilisateur
Divers (astuces, actualités, sécurité)

Ajout de sur-couche possible pour une mise en forme Web 2.0 : jawstats

Pour ce qui concerne l'analyse statistique de consultation d'un site Web, la question du choix du logiciel peut se poser. Pour choisir entre AWStats et PhpMyVisites, certaines situations sont déterminantes :

- l'insertion de code Javascript n'est pas possible dans les pages HTML dont on veut mesurer la consultation => AWStats
- le type de suivi recherché est plutôt de type ciblé à l'usage d'un utilisateur non informaticien => phpMyVisites
- il n'est pas possible de mettre en place une base MySQL et un serveur Web dédié pour gérer les statistiques => AWStats
- mon serveur est très consulté => AWStats ou PhPMyVisites sur un serveur supportant lui aussi de nombreuses requêtes
- un administrateur système qui cherche à surveiller une série de sites, qu'ils soient web, ftp ou mail, préfèrera certainement AWStats qui sait les traiter tous de la même façon.
- les aspects sécurité de AWStats peuvent être déterminants.

Commentaires

Responsable thématique précédent

Cette fiche a d'abord été suivie par le responsable thématique Jacquelin Charbonnel. Thierry Dostes l'a reprise en février 2012.